Long-reach tools

Long reach tools are an essential part of the car-opening kit used by locksmiths for car keys and other lockout professionals. These tools are designed to not cause damage the door of a car. They also permit locksmiths to gain access to the inner door handles and locks. These tools come in a variety shapes and sizes and some even come with different tips for various vehicles.

A few of the most commonly used tools for opening cars include a slim jim tool, which looks like a piece of wire with loops on either end. This tool is used to create an opening in the door latch in order to insert a wedge or other locking mechanism. Air wedges are another well-known car opening tool. They are used to create an even bigger hole in the door to allow the lockpick can be put in. These tools are usually filled with nitrogen to help them resist the pressure of the lockpick.

Other kinds of long-reach tools include multi-piece tools that extend up to 76 inches. They have the handle base, which has a pre-bent extension as well as an interchangeable tip. These tools are available in different lengths, and some have a glow-in-the-dark tip for use in dim lighting conditions.

Immobilisers

Immobilisers prevent thieves from hotwiring cars by preventing the engine from being started when the wrong key is used. It works by transmitting digital codes from the fob unit to the vehicle control unit. If this code is not compatible the fob, then several vital parts of the car - including the ignition system and the fuel system are disabled. This stops the mobile car key locksmith from moving and the criminal will have to use a device that can capture and copy the code transmitted by the fob. The latest fobs have a unique ID and a separate cryptographic code that helps fight against theft of relays. This has not completely eliminated the issue of relay theft, as criminals still use devices to intercept the transmission and transmit fake signals to fool the car's control system. Add a Faraday bag that blocks the transmission of signals to your keys to fight this kind of crime.

It is important to confirm that the immobilisers you are contemplating are approved by Thatcham. This organisation is a not-for-profit research center that certifies automobile alarms and security systems. Its grading and approval system seeks to reduce insurance premiums without compromising security standards.

For older models or cars that do not have an immobiliser, add-ons from the aftermarket are available. If you're considering buying an aftermarket immobiliser, make sure it's Thatcham-approved and only be fitted by a professional who is qualified. These systems are complicated and if not properly installed or connected to the key of the vehicle, they could fail or cause the vehicle to malfunction.
